Author: Andrew Clements, Illustrated By Brian Selznick
Title: The School Story
Main Characters: Natalie Nelson, the writer, and Zoe Reisman, her best friend
Setting: This story takes place in New York City
Plot: This story was about two elementary school girls that took on the dream to become a published author.
Personal Endorsement: This was a really good book and it shows what can happen when people have support within their dreams. It shows the power of friendship without jealousy or envy. It also shows the power of focus and what can happen when one doesn't give up on whatever project they are working on. At the end of the day it does seem like a lot of what a person can accomplish is due to who a person knows. If these young ladies didn't have some of the people in their lives who supported them things wouldn't have been able to happen the way that they did.
